Energypac organizes fire safety training at school
Share

Energypac Power Generation PLC has recently held a fire safety campaign at Shailat High School located in Sripur, Gazipur with a view to raising awareness among the students, teachers and other staff of the school about fire safety protocols, according to press release.

Fire safety is now a burning issue in the country. On an average, around 73 fire incidents occurred per day in the country in 2024. In many cases, it is observed that people do not possess adequate knowledge about what to do if fire breaks out. To create awareness, Energypac organized this at the premises of Shailat High School.

Around 250 participants including students, teachers, parents, and guardians participated in the training session. The event featured an engaging hands-on session where students actively took part in learning critical fire safety techniques. Participants gained valuable knowledge on fire prevention, the proper use of extinguishers, and safe evacuation procedures. The session was particularly effective in instilling a culture of safety among young students and fostering a sense of responsibility within the broader school community.

It is mentionable that Energypac remains committed to leading impactful CSR initiatives focused on public safety, sustainability, and community development across Bangladesh.
